From the production house of TBS Sparkle, this BL series is an adaptation based on the Yaoi manga 'I Will Not Reach You' by Mika which centres around the fears of risking a friendship for a romance. It stars Kentaro Maeda, a member of the long running Kamen Rider superhero franchise, and rookie actor Kashiwagi Haru from the boyband Bullet Train as the main couple Yamato and Kakeru. Both are seemingly well known to the younger Japanese demographic and their appearance in a Yaoi project is being seen as a further positive move in helping project the BL genre to a wider mainstream audience. Support comes from Matsumoto Reo ('Jack O'Frost'), Hito Tanaka, Momose Takumi and Takato Fukushima playing the roles of Hosaka Yui, Fujino Kousuke, Amamiya Souichiro and Yukochi Yuzura, all friends of Yamato and Kakeru; while Tomomi Nakai plays Akane Toyama who is attracted to Kakeru and Ayaka Konno plays Yamato's younger sister Mikoto. The series has been directed by Masahide Izumi Takayoshi working alongside Masataka Hayashi ('Cherry Magic').
SYNOPSIS: "Childhood friends Yamato and Kakeru share a unique bond. Yamato is both handsome and academically accomplished, often the target of girls confessing a crush on him. In contrast, Kakeru’s grades are average, but his cheerful personality makes him a likable presence. Despite their classmates confusion over the extent of their close friendship, Yamato and Kakeru have been inseparable since childhood. Yamato cares deeply for Kakeru, faithfully accompanying him to supplementary classes he need not attend. While Yamato may appear reserved, shy and lacking in conversation skills, Kakeru believes that everyone should recognise his kindness, intelligence and capability. One day, Kakeru asks Yamato if there is someone he secretly likes, given his tendency to decline confessions. Yamato’s murmured response which sounds like his name leaves Kakeru puzzled. He dismisses the idea that it could actually be about him, but for Yamato, it’s a heartfelt admission. However, Kakeru remains oblivious to the emotions Yamato is trying to convey..."

There are eight 25 minute episodes, the first of which will premiere on Wednesday 4th October. No international platform has so far been announced.
